javascript后退按钮显示事件侦听器调用?
我有一个javascript事件监听器函数,它等待用户单击任何链接,然后显示一个加载框,然后进入下一页 如果用户单击“上一步”按钮,仍会显示加载框?有没有一种方法可以在不强制刷新的情况下删除它javascript后退按钮显示事件侦听器调用?,javascript,javascript-events,Javascript,Javascript Events,我有一个javascript事件监听器函数,它等待用户单击任何链接,然后显示一个加载框,然后进入下一页 如果用户单击“上一步”按钮,仍会显示加载框?有没有一种方法可以在不强制刷新的情况下删除它 function loading_show() { document.getElementById("loading").removeAttribute("style"); } // Function to add event listener to t function load() {
function loading_show() {
document.getElementById("loading").removeAttribute("style");
}
// Function to add event listener to t
function load() {
var el = document.getElementsByTagName("a");
for (var i = 0; i < el.length; i++)
{
el[i].addEventListener("click", loading_show, false);
}
}
function init() {
// quit if this function has already been called
if (arguments.callee.done) return;
// flag this function so we don't do the same thing twice
arguments.callee.done = true;
// do stuff
load();
};
var _timer = setInterval(function() {
if (/loaded|complete/.test(document.readyState)) {
clearInterval(_timer);
init(); // call the onload handler
}
}, 10);
函数加载_show(){
document.getElementById(“加载”).removeAttribute(“样式”);
}
//函数将事件侦听器添加到t
函数加载(){
var el=document.getElementsByTagName(“a”);
对于(变量i=0;i
另外,我正在为移动环境开发,我不想使用jQuery,所以请不要建议使用它。您可以尝试使用“beforeuload”事件捕获它 以下是如何使用它: